Output ef7095535183563ba1482f2fa1630d591a7adc138555f8a15ee62e7e5905b54a:0

value
2184551270
script pubkey
OP_0 OP_PUSHBYTES_20 4e1c39cd110670f106dc1851f0800c98cd83a279
address
ltc1qfcwrnng3qec0zpkurpglpqqvnrxc8gneumy93a
transaction
ef7095535183563ba1482f2fa1630d591a7adc138555f8a15ee62e7e5905b54a
spent
true